What companies run services between Sovereign Hill, VIC, Australia and Avalon Airport (AVV), Australia?

V-Line Buses operates a bus from Sovereign Hill/Main Rd to Geelong Station/Railway Tce 5 times a week. Tickets cost $1–15 and the journey takes 1h 29m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bradshaw St/Magpie St to Avalon Airport Terminal/Airport Dr via Ballarat Station, Ballarat Station, Deer Park Station, Lara Station, and Lara Station/Hicks St in around 3h 39m.
